Tissue tropism and parasite burden ofToxoplasma gondii RH strain in experimentally infected mice

         

摘要

ABSTRACT Objective:To evaluate parasite distribution and tissue tropism ofToxoplasma gondii tachyzoites in experimentally infected mice using real timeQPCR.Methods:In this survey16Balb/c mice were inoculated with1×104 alive tachyzoites ofToxoplasma gondiiRH strain.After1,2,3 days post infection and the last day(before death), different tissues of mice including blood, brain, eye, liver, spleen, kidney, heart and muscle were harvested.Following tissuesDNA extraction, the parasite burden was quantified using real timeQPCR targeting theB1 gene(451 bp).Results:It showed thatToxoplasmaafter intraperitoneal injection was able to movement to various tissues in 24 hours.Parasite burden was high in all tissues but the most number of parasites were observed in kidney, heart and liver, respectively.Conclusions:These data provide significant baseline information aboutToxoplasmapathogenesis, vaccine monitoring and drug efficiency.
